How can the Focus ST be faster when the manual BRZ has the better power to weight ratio.

Focus ST = 3200lbs, FWD, 246hp
BRZ = 2750lbs, RWD, 200hp

If both had the same driver, same tires, same conditions. The BRZ will be faster in accleration.
Not sure where you got that the BRZ has a better power to weight ratio but let's actually put the numbers into a calculator. Given the same 175 pound driver:

Focus ST
Weight=3200 (car) + 175 (driver) = 3375lbs
Power (crank) = 252hp

Weight/Power = 3375/252 = 13.4 lbs/hp

BRZ/FRS
Weight=2750 (car) + 175 (driver) = 2925lbs
Power (crank) = 200hp

Weight/Power = 2925/200 = 14.6 lbs/hp

That is a difference of over 8% in the ST's favor when it comes to power to weight ratios. Also, that is taking crank hp. The BRZ/FRS loses a larger percentage to the ground than the ST due to the differences of FWD and RWD (in the area of an additional 3% power). And we won't even get into talking about the difference in torque....
